Sen. Mark Warner, D-Va., acknowledged on Monday that the Biden administration “screwed up” in the case of securing the southern border whereas additionally criticizing the Trump administration for arresting principally migrants who haven’t any felony document.
Throughout an look on Fox Information’ “Particular Report,” Warner was requested if he agreed with new Virginia Rep. Abigail Spanberger’s transfer to finish state regulation enforcement collaboration with ICE to seize unlawful immigrants with felony data.
Warner responded by citing data exhibiting that 75% of the folks arrested by ICE in Virginia haven’t any felony document, even because the federal authorities continues to assert it’s focusing on the “worst of the worst” in its efforts to hold out President Donald Trump’s mass deportation agenda.
“They might have come throughout illegally into our nation, however 75% of the folks to have been arrested haven’t any additional felony document,” he stated.

Pressed on whether or not Virginia ought to work with ICE on the individuals who do have felony data, Warner admitted the Biden administration “screwed up the border” however that focusing on these with felony data just isn’t what is occurring now beneath Trump.
“Let’s probably work on those that have felony data,” he stated. “However that’s totally different than what’s occurring proper now, and the Biden administration screwed up the border, I will be the primary to acknowledge that, however the thought of masked ICE brokers choosing up mothers dropping off their children, of us going to work and, as we have seen a minimum of within the circumstance in Minnesota, typically the place children are being left within the automotive after their dad and mom that will or could not have been really criminals are being picked up.”
“I simply assume there must be a collaborative effort, and to this point, a minimum of based mostly upon what I’ve seen in Minnesota, there’s just about no collaboration between native regulation enforcement and ICE, and I consider that’s as a result of ICE ways,” the senator continued.

This comes amid protests over an incident earlier this month in Minneapolis, the place Renee Nicole Good, a U.S. citizen, was fatally shot by ICE agent Jonathan Ross, who fired into the driving force’s windshield and open window from the facet of the automobile and subsequently exclaimed “f—ing b—-” because the automotive crashed into one other parked automobile.
Democrats and native residents have condemned the taking pictures as a homicide and known as for Ross’ prosecution, whereas the Trump administration and Republican lawmakers have defended the incident by arguing that it was a justified taking pictures.
Per week after that taking pictures, an ICE agent shot an alleged unlawful immigrant within the leg throughout an arrest try. The Division of Homeland Safety claimed the agent fired on the suspect as a result of he was “fearing for his life and security” after the person resisted arrest and “violently assaulted the officer.”
